Role:Conductor PerformerMaria Ferré was born on May 12, 1985, in Madrid, Spain. She was born into a family of musicians, with her father being a renowned classical guitarist and her mother a pianist. From a young age, Maria was exposed to classical music and began playing the piano at the age of four. Maria's talent for music was evident from a young age, and she began performing in public at the age of six. She quickly gained a reputation as a prodigy, and by the age of ten, she had won several national and international piano competitions. In 1996, Maria was accepted into the prestigious Juilliard School in New York City, where she studied under the tutelage of renowned pianist and teacher, Yoheved Kaplinsky. During her time at Juilliard, Maria continued to win numerous awards and competitions, including the Van Cliburn International Piano Competition and the International Tchaikovsky Competition. After graduating from Juilliard in 2006, Maria embarked on a successful career as a concert pianist. She has performed with some of the world's leading orchestras, including the New York Philharmonic, the Berlin Philharmonic, and the London Symphony Orchestra. One of Maria's most memorable performances was her debut at Carnegie Hall in 2008. She performed a program of works by Beethoven, Chopin, and Liszt to critical acclaim, with The New York Times describing her playing as "virtuosic and deeply expressive." Maria has also been recognized for her recordings, with her album of Chopin's complete Nocturnes receiving widespread praise. The album was named "Best Classical Album of the Year" by Gramophone magazine and was nominated for a Grammy Award. In addition to her performing career, Maria is also a dedicated teacher. She has taught masterclasses at universities and conservatories around the world and has mentored numerous young pianists who have gone on to successful careers in music. Maria's dedication to music has been recognized with numerous awards and honors. In 2010, she was awarded the prestigious Avery Fisher Career Grant, which recognizes outstanding young musicians who have the potential for major careers in music. She was also named a Steinway Artist in 2012, joining a select group of pianists who are recognized for their excellence in performance and dedication to the piano. Despite her success, Maria remains humble and dedicated to her craft. She continues to practice for several hours a day and is always seeking to improve her playing. Her passion for music is evident in every performance, and she is widely regarded as one of the most talented and accomplished pianists of her generation.More....
